WebFeb 2, 2024 · Hairloss in Your Pet By Adrienne Kruzer Updated on 02/02/20 Fotosearch / Getty Images Sometimes your chinchilla loses large clumps of hair when he jumps out of your hands, but it's not because he is getting … WebSep 1, 2024 · Chinchilla fur has three levels of color: the underfur, the bar, and the tip. As you would expect, the underfur is the portion of the fur that is closest to the chinchilla’s skin and is generally a grey color. The bar is a portion of white in-between the underfur and the tip that provides some contrast to the chinchilla’s fur color. WebJul 21, 2014 · Chinchilla fur became popular in the 1700s, and the animals were hunted nearly to extinction by 1900. Once very common, chinchillas … shunt patency studyWebchinchilla, (genus Chinchilla), either of two South American species of medium-sized rodents long valued for their extremely soft and thick fur. Once very common, chinchillas were hunted almost to extinction. They remain scarce in the wild but are raised commercially and also sold as housepets.
